当用户在TPWallet中发现“看不到转入记录”时,往往并非单一原因,而是链上数据、钱包索引、合约环境与账户状态共同作用的结果。作为从事链上资产治理与合约风控的研究员,我建议从以下维度进行全链路排查,并理解其背后代表的长期技术趋势。
一、高级资产配置视角:展示层与资产账本可能脱节。TPWallet的“转入记录”通常依赖地址关联与交易索引服务。如果你的资产配置涉及多链、多地址,或启用了新的接收地址轮换,可能出现:链上确实已到账,但钱包端未将该地址纳入索引范围,或索引尚未同步完成。进一步地,若你在交易所/聚合器上转账到“旧地址”,而钱包当前展示的是“新账户地址”,也会造成看似“缺失”的错觉。建议对照接收地址与链网络ID逐一校验。
二、合约环境:代币到账≠代币记录展示。对于ERC-20、BEP-20等代币,转入记录可能由合约事件(Transfer事件)触发索引。如果你转入的是合约托管、代币包装(Wrapped token)、或与特定路由器/桥合约相关,钱包端要识别“事件签名+合约地址+是否为可追踪代币”才能展示。常见失败点包括:
1)合约地址写错或代币“别名”不匹配;2)代币合约已升级/迁移导致事件归属变化;3)使用了非标准代币实现(Transfer事件不按规范输出)。因此需要用区块浏览器核对交易哈希与日志(Logs)中的事件。
三、市场观察报告:拥堵与确认策略导致的延迟。高峰期网络拥堵会让交易确认时间拉长,钱包只在达到最小确认数后才更新资产流水。若你的转账发生在跨链桥或二次打包阶段,还可能经历“第一段已入账、第二段未完成”的状态。此时TPWallet可能不会展示完整“转入记录”,而仅显示余额或暂时不刷新历史。
四、全球化智能化发展:索引服务与智能化路由的差异。全球化钱包生态越来越依赖“智能路由”和“本地缓存+远程索引”混合架构。不同地区节点、不同数据源对链上查询策略不一,可能出现同一交易在不同时间点被收录。建议在TPWallet中切换网络、刷新缓存,必要时以“交易哈希导入/查询”作为强校验手段。

五、硬分叉与协议升级:链分叉后历史映射可能变化。若你使用的公链在进行硬分叉或共识升级,可能出现:同一区块高度在不同分支上的归属差异,导致索引服务对“主链历史”的采纳方式不同。对于较早阶段的交易,某些钱包会延迟重建索引,或暂时无法展示历史流水。应优先确认该交易属于当前主链。

六、账户注销与权限更替:账户生命周期会影响展示。若你注销或更换钱包账户、撤销导入、或更换了助记词对应的地址派生路径,TPWallet会以新账户状态重新计算资产与历史。某些“看不到转入记录”其实是因为钱包当前账户并不等于发生转账的接收方地址。
详细流程(建议按顺序执行):
1)在区块浏览器输入交易哈希:确认是否已成功上链,并核对接收地址是否与你钱包显示地址一致;
2)若是代币:进入交易的Logs查看Transfer事件的合约地址是否等于你在TPWallet中添加的代币合约;
3)确认链与网络ID:主网/测试网、BSC/BNB Smart Chain、Polygon/Arbitrum等切换错误会导致“找不到”;
4)检查确认数与跨链阶段:等待到足够确认或桥完成后再刷新;
5)在TPWallet内更新:切换网络→刷新/重启→重新同步代币;必要时手动添加代币合约;
6)若涉及硬分叉:确认交易在主链而非旧分支;
7)若涉及账户注销/更换派生路径:用同一私钥/助记词在相同路径下验证地址匹配。
结论与前景:TPWallet看不到转入记录并不必然意味着资金丢失。更重要的是,它反映了未来钱包系统在“链上真实—索引一致—合约事件可识别—账户生命周期可追溯”四个环节的工程挑战。随着全球化智能化发展,钱包将更依赖标准化事件、统一索引协议与可验证查询(如以交易哈希为中心的证据链),但短期仍需用户通过上述流程完成自证与定位。保持对合约环境与协议升级的敏感,能显著降低误判成本。
评论
LunaTech
我遇到过跨链桥第一段进去了,但钱包历史没刷新,最后用交易哈希在浏览器核对才确认没丢。
小灰灰在跑
代币合约地址加错会直接导致看不到转入记录,这点太容易被忽略了。
CryptoMing
硬分叉/升级后索引重建延迟的情况,确实会让钱包先显示余额不显示流水。
NovaKaito
建议大家优先用“交易哈希+Logs”做强校验,比等钱包同步靠谱。
链上观星人
账户更换或派生路径不同也会导致地址对不上,所以别只盯着钱包界面。